Jalandhar, August 4

Senior Congress leader and former Punjab minister Chaudhary Jagjit Singh died of a heart attack this morning at a hospital here. He was 82.

Congress leader Virendra Sharma told PTI that Jagjit Singh began to sweat and complained of chest pain around 5 am following which he was taken to a private hospital where he passed away.

He is survived by his wife, two sons and two daughters.

Jagjit, a prominent Dalit leader, became an MLA for the first time in 1980.

A five-time party MLA, he was Local Bodies minister in Captain Amarinder Singh's government between 2002 to 2007. He was also leader of the opposition in Punjab Assembly once.

Jagjit's younger brother Santokh Singh Chaudhary is the Congress MP from Jalandhar. —PTI
